#include <cxxtools/log.h>
#include <cxxtools/smartptr.h>
#include <cxxtools/refcounted.h>
#include <iostream>
#include <vector>
#include <stdexcept>
#include <cxxtools/arg.h>
#include <cxxtools/thread.h>
#include <sys/time.h>
#include <iomanip>
namespace bench
{
log_define("bench")
class Logtester : public cxxtools::RefCounted
{
cxxtools::AttachedThread thread;
unsigned long count;
unsigned long loops;
unsigned long enabled;
public:
Logtester(unsigned long count_,
unsigned long loops_,
unsigned long enabled_)
: thread( cxxtools::callable(*this, &Logtester::run) ),
count(count_),
loops(loops_),
enabled(enabled_)
{ }
void start()
{ thread.start(); }
void join()
{ thread.join(); }
void setCount(unsigned long count_) { count = count_; }
void setLoops(unsigned long loops_) { loops = loops_; }
void setEnabled(bool sw = true) { enabled = sw; }
void run();
};
void Logtester::run()
{
for (unsigned long l = 0; l < loops; ++l)
{
if (enabled)
for (unsigned long i = 0; i < count; ++i)
log_info("info message");
else
for (unsigned long i = 0; i < count; ++i)
log_debug("debug message");
}
}
}
int main(int argc, char* argv[])
{
try
{
cxxtools::Arg<double> total(argc, argv, 'T', 5.0); // minimum runtime
cxxtools::Arg<long> loops(argc, argv, 'l', 1000);
cxxtools::Arg<unsigned> numthreads(argc, argv, 't', 1);
cxxtools::Arg<bool> enable(argc, argv, 'e');
cxxtools::Arg<bool> consolelog(argc, argv, 'c');
cxxtools::Arg<unsigned short> udpport(argc, argv, 'u');
cxxtools::Arg<std::string> logfile(argc, argv, 'f', "/dev/null");
cxxtools::Arg<bool> norollingfile(argc, argv, 'r');
cxxtools::LogConfiguration logConfiguration;
logConfiguration.setRootLevel(cxxtools::Logger::LOG_LEVEL_INFO);
unsigned settingCount = 0;
if (consolelog)
++settingCount;
if (logfile.isSet())
++settingCount;
if (udpport.isSet())
{
++settingCount;
logConfiguration.setLoghost("", udpport);
}
if (settingCount > 1)
{
std::cerr << "only one of -c, -u or -f must be specified" << std::endl;
return -1;
}
if (logfile.isSet() || settingCount == 0)
{
if (norollingfile || !logfile.isSet())
logConfiguration.setFile(logfile);
else
logConfiguration.setFile(logfile, 1024*1024, 0);
}
log_init(logConfiguration);
unsigned long count = 1;
double T;
typedef std::vector<cxxtools::SmartPtr<bench::Logtester> > Threads;
Threads threads;
for (unsigned t = 0; t < numthreads; ++t)
threads.push_back(new bench::Logtester(count, loops.getValue() / numthreads.getValue(), enable));
while (count > 0)
{
std::cout << "count=" << (count * loops) << '\t' << std::flush;
for (Threads::iterator it = threads.begin(); it != threads.end(); ++it)
(*it)->setCount(count);
struct timeval tv0;
struct timeval tv1;
gettimeofday(&tv0, 0);
if (threads.size() == 1)
{
(*threads.begin())->run();
}
else
{
for (Threads::iterator it = threads.begin(); it != threads.end(); ++it)
(*it)->start();
for (Threads::iterator it = threads.begin(); it != threads.end(); ++it)
(*it)->join();
}
gettimeofday(&tv1, 0);
double t0 = tv0.tv_sec + tv0.tv_usec / 1e6;
double t1 = tv1.tv_sec + tv1.tv_usec / 1e6;
T = t1 - t0;
std::cout.precision(6);
std::cout << " T=" << T << '\t' << std::setprecision(12) << (count / T * loops)
<< " msg/s" << std::endl;
if (T >= total)
break;
count <<= 1;
}
}
catch (const std::exception& e)
{
std::cerr << e.what() << std::endl;
return -1;
}
}
